MONDAY MORNING DEBRIEF: How the Qatar GP ended up being far better than damage limitation for Ferrari


Ferrari came into Qatar strongly suspecting that this would be one its less competitive races of the season.
In their fight with McLaren for the constructors' title, it was probably going to be a case of damage limitation in order to keep the battle alive for it to be decided at the Abu Dhabi finale where the expectation was the car would be more competitive.
